JERSEY SKYLANDS LABRADOR RETRIEVER CLUB, INC.

AWARDS DESCRIPTION

Members are responsible for applying for their awards with the required verifying documents. Certificate awards are available to all members, but competitive awards are available only to full members who have earned additional privileges. Awards cover achievements that were completed during the previous calendar year (i.e. the award year). In the following, service dogs include guide dogs, hearing dogs, handicapped-assistance dogs, police dogs, narcotics or bomb squad dogs, search & rescue dogs, or others trained and employed by organizations as deemed acceptable. Canine Good Citizen and Therapy Dog Certificates are not eligible for awards.

COMPETITIVE AWARDS:
One award available to each sex in each category. Copies of the AKC Gazette Awards pages are required.

Top Specials Dog/Bitch: Highest number labs defeated as a finished champion during the aware year as a BOB or BOS only.
Top Winners Dog/Bitch: Highest number of Labs defeated from the classes during the award year, as a winner, BOW, BOB, or BOS only.
Top Junior Dog/Bitch: Highest cumulative number of Labs defeated by dog/bitch under two years of age at the time of the placements, as a Winner, RW, BOW, BOB, or BOS only. The wins may be from prior years through the award year. The dog/bitch need not be a finished champion. The award may be applied for more than once for the same dog but no later than the year following the dog’s second birthday.
Top Obedience Dog/Bitch: Highest average of all qualifying score in A classes or Novice B classes for title completed during the award year, or highest average of all scores in Open B or Utility B attained during the award year.

NEW TITLE CERTIFICATE AWARDS:
An award for completing one of the following titles during the award year; they may have begun earlier. Foreign titles are included. A copy of the official certificate or AKC Gazette Awards page is required.

New Champion        New Obedience Title         New Agility Title
New Field Title         New Tracking Title
New Hunting Title     New Working Certificate

OUTSTANDING ACHIEVEMENT CERTIFICATE AWARDS:
Presented for achievements that are truly outstanding. A copy of the AKC Gazette Awards page or a letter of satisfactory performance from a service organization is required.

Conformation: Received three five-point majors; four four-point major; five three point majors.
Obedience: All qualifying legs with scores of 195 or better without NQ’s; or a High in Trial.
Hunting: Received all qualifying wings without an NQ.
Field: Any placement at a field trial.
All Around Retriever: Must be a Breed Champion, and a CD in obedience or higher, and a JR Hunter or higher, or a Tracking Title holder or higher. Only the last title must be completed during the award year.
All Around Producing Dog: A minimum of four get achieving titles during the award year including titles above plus graduated service dogs.
All Around Producing Bitch: Same as for Dog, except a minimum of two get.
Community Service (Person): The owner have a minimum of four therapy visitation, four educational programs with dogs, or one search and rescue mission.
